Brian Bascome

Hello, my name is Brian and I am a USPTA certified teaching professional with a passion for developing players of all ages and abilities. I played varsity tennis for Penn State Altoona, where I won the AMCC Championship for #1 singles and #1 doubles. I currently am a tennis professional at the Palm Beach Gardens Tennis Center, running programs for children ranging from 4-17-years-old. I also have experience working with adults in private and group settings.

Simultaneously with tennis, I obtained a masters degree in school counseling. I have experience mentoring children with issues larger than tennis for 3 years now, ranging from elementary to high school age. I currently advise children on a daily basis as a guidance counselor at Rickards Middle School. In addition to developing proper stroke technique, my background will facilitate the right mindset to win both on and off the court.

I always structure my teaching style around the ability and age of my students. Success early on is key, and I'm keenly aware of how the confidence factor plays in a tennis match. I start by asking my students what their long term goals are with tennis, and from there we create a map or plan on how to get there. This creates motivation during times of stress or when resiliency is needed. When developing proper stroke technique, I start off with small progressions. In tennis, you can't go from 0 to 60. Like a math equation, each step must be mastered before moving on to the next. I'm always aware of when we need to go back and break a stroke down further.
